Every e-Portfolio in our system gets a unique URL, chosen by the user. This has some huge advantages, such as a single short address that can be given out. It also has a disadvantage as our user base grows – it can be more difficult to find an unused address.

We’ve received a few requests over the last month for quicker feedback on whether an address is available, so here it is. In a few days, when you enter a URL, the page will immediately update and let you know if that URL is taken.

That’s right! Now you can embed Vimeo videos in your Digication e-Portfolio!

Vimeo provides a versatile video player, the best quality video on the web today and even supports HD videos. With these benefits you might want to give Vimeo a try before uploading your next movie file to YouTube.

To take advantage of this new feature, just add a Video Module to your e-Portfolio. Edit the module and select the Media from Web tab and paste in the Embed code listed in Vimeo next to the video.

Note: You can also embed Vimeo videos if you are using the Rich Text Module or Gallery Module – following the same directions above for Inserting Media or Editing/Adding Images and Videos.

We’re in the final stages of testing a new feature within the Digication Assessment Management System that we’re calling e-Portfolio Snapshots.

If you’re using the assessment features at your school, you’ve probably seen the ‘Submit Evidence’ screen. This allows a user to store information that contributes to an assignment or shows progress towards a goal/standard. We currently support entering rich text, uploading of files, and linking to an e-Portfolio.

The e-Portfolio feature has been enormously popular, as it allows a student to both demonstrate their work and store it for grading. This is, however, just a link to the e-Portfolio as it looks now, not how it looked when the user submitted it. Schools have expressed an interest in using the e-Portfolios as a repository of information towards their accreditation reviews. For this to work, the e-Portfolios need to remain the same.

Once this feature is available, all e-Portfolio evidence will point to an archive of the work. It will always reflect the e-Portfolio as it looked when submitted.

Several things to note:

For our existing Assessment users, we will automatically snapshot all your existing e-Portfolio evidence. The submission date will not change, but the snapshot will be of the e-Portfolio state when we launched, not when it submitted.

When the Firefox and Safari browsers no longer supported the browser based spell check we got busy creating a custom version for you.  The new Digication e-Portfolio Spell Checker is now available in the Rich Text Module and Gallery Module caption editors.

This feature is great for writing programs, teacher education programs, and others that require large amounts of text to be included in the e-Portfolio.

When you have completed writing your text (or anytime your adding or editing text) click on the Spell Checker icon. Any misspelled words will be displayed with a dotted red line underneath so you can easily make your changes before saving and publishing your text.

The spell checker is currently English only but we can add other languages if requested.
